The Baudouin Marine Engine 6 M16 is a high-performance 6-cylinder inline diesel engine, delivering 264 kW (360 hp) at 2100 RPM. Designed for marine applications, it offers exceptional fuel efficiency, durability, and compliance with IMO II emission regulations.
Key Features
- Mechanical inline injection pump with flanged mechanical governor.
- Fuel-efficient operation at 215 g/kWh.
- Extended MTBO (Mean Time Between Overhauls), reducing maintenance costs.
- Fresh/raw water heat exchanger with thermostatic valves for efficient cooling.
- Full-flow oil filters and fresh-water cooled lube oil cooler for engine longevity.
P2 Duty Cycle
- Application: Continuous
- Engine Load Variations: Numerous
- Average Engine Load Factor: 30% – 80%
- Annual Working Time: 3,000 – 5,000 hours
- Time at Full Load: 8 hours per 12-hour cycle
Technical Specifications: Baudouin Marine Engine 6 M16
Power Output | 264 kW (360 hp) @ 2100 RPM |
---|---|
Engine Speed | 650 – 2100 RPM |
Fuel Consumption | 215 g/kWh |
Number of Cylinders | 6 in-line |
Total Displacement | 9.70 liters |
Bore & Stroke | 126 x 130 mm |
Compression Ratio | 17:1 |
Engine Rotation | Counterclockwise (ISO 1204 standard) |
Idle Speed | 650 RPM |
Flywheel Housing | SAE 1 |
Flywheel | SAE 14” |
Cooling System | Fresh/raw water heat exchanger with integrated thermostatic valves |
Lubrication System | Full-flow oil filters, fresh-water cooled lube oil cooler |
Fuel System | Inline mechanical injection pump, duplex fuel filters |
Electrical System | 24V, electrical starter, 55A battery charger |
Operating Conditions Baudouin Marine Engine 6M16
- Ambient Temperature: 25°C (77°F) – Max: 45°C (113°F)
- Barometric Pressure: 100 kPa
- Relative Humidity: 30% R
- Raw Water Temperature: 25°C (77°F) – Max: 32°C (90°F)
- Fuel Density: 0.840 ± 0.005 kg/L
- Lower Calorific Power: 42,700 kJ/kg
Applications
The Baudouin Marine Engine 6 M16 is suitable for:
- Passenger vessels
- Harbor tugboats
- Coastal freighters
- Tuna boats & seiners
- Supply vessels & oceanographic research vessels
- Commercial pleasure crafts
